Thnaks didn't realise how many development players there were, I should have read the sticked thread!

With Talakai now confirmed that is him plus Josh Carr, Jackson Ferris, Kyle Patterson, Daniel Vasquez and Jack A. Williams on Dev contracts.

We are by no means required to promote any of them over signing someone different. It's possible if Morris left we sign someone who was on a train and trial at another club but didn't get a contract, or try poach someone off a development contract elsewhere, or just someone else from NSW/QLD Cup or U20s that had a good year last year but isn't NRL contracted. But it is probably likely, especially if Morris left inside the first 5 weeks of the season that one of our development players would get the call up.

1) they have previously impressed enough we wanted to start paying them to keep them around
2) they are already training with the team full time
3) it's cheaper... we are already paying them potentially up to 75k so we just top it up a little and shift it into the cap

The longer the season goes on the more likely we would give the spots (Morris replacement and 30th squad spot) to other people.
ie if Wes Lolo was killing it for Jets and we felt we needed a prop he might jump anyone on the development list for a spot in the top 30.
